你查询的IP:[116.4.146.152]  地理位置:中国–广东–东莞

最新查询166.111.25.37 124.72.1.96 122.4.18.231 202.96.193.149 121.4.193.60 123.232.162.45 58.154.10.7 60.63.64.241 218.96.75.55 116.4.146.152 219.216.226.145 203.92.175.250 119.108.113.7 203.91.120.192 61.240.187.218 119.20.129.175 61.240.53.152 116.69.33.208 221.12.222.22 222.240.58.87 211.144.105.185 210.2.161.114 122.4.77.156 202.127.128.226 120.136.128.191 121.201.144.134 203.86.64.173 116.13.75.161 119.3.3.168 210.185.192.164 202.127.216.88